Santa Maria 1/65 wooden boat Amati
Columbus' flagship, the Santa Maria, which the navigator called "Nao", is one of the most famous ships in the history of navigation.
This type of ship was certainly native to the Cantabrian coast and was originally called La Gallega.
Its owner, Juan de la Cosa, participated in the Columbus expedition.
Code: 1409
Scale: 1:65
Length: 54 cm
Laser-pre-cut parts in a very precise way, wood and fittings of good quality, detailed plans and assembly instructions.
